fix(frontend): fixed LAST_7_DAYS/LAST_30_DAYS/PREV_7_DAYS/PREV_30_DAYS time periods (#3036)

This commit is contained in:
Kraiem Taha Yassine 2025-02-17 16:39:17 +01:00 committed by GitHub
parent f1614b6626
commit f8a1c9447b
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-36,12 +36,12 @@ function getRange(rangeName, offset) {
);
case LAST_7_DAYS:
return Interval.fromDateTimes(
now.minus({ days: 7 }).endOf("day"),
now.minus({ days: 6 }).startOf("day"),
now.endOf("day")
);
case LAST_30_DAYS:
return Interval.fromDateTimes(
now.minus({ days: 30 }).startOf("day"),
now.minus({ days: 29 }).startOf("day"),
now.endOf("day")
);
case THIS_MONTH:
@ -55,12 +55,12 @@ function getRange(rangeName, offset) {
return Interval.fromDateTimes(now.minus({ hours: 48 }), now.minus({ hours: 24 }));
case PREV_7_DAYS:
return Interval.fromDateTimes(
now.minus({ days: 14 }).startOf("day"),
now.minus({ days: 13 }).startOf("day"),
now.minus({ days: 7 }).endOf("day")
);
case PREV_30_DAYS:
return Interval.fromDateTimes(
now.minus({ days: 60 }).startOf("day"),
now.minus({ days: 59 }).startOf("day"),
now.minus({ days: 30 }).endOf("day")
);
default: